Plaid X: Can I flip it?

This site may earn commission on affiliate links.
So I originally ordered a Plaid X back in June 2021 with seven seats. However, they no longer offer this option. I was given a six seat option as a free upgrade. I really need that 7th seat.

So my question is this. Can I take delivery of this vehicle then flip around and sell it for a profit?

Thanks.

If flipping for profit were your intention you would be violating the terms of your order agreement.

If you took delivery and decided the vehicle is not for you, you are free to do with it as you wish.

they seem to be selling for around $140-145k looking at sold listings. which, factoring in taxes,reg and all the "flip" is more or less a break even, if it sells at all. seems like a lot of hassle to go through, I would see if they can refund you the order fee for changing the seat configuration on you.
 
So I bought one, wasn’t satisfied with it, sold it a few days later and today Tesla emailed me and said I violated their reseller terms and banned for me life from ordering future teslas.

They cancelled my cybertruck order too. They said the decision is final and I have no one I can talk to to explain I didn’t order one over a year ago to simply flip it. I genuinely thought it wasn’t for me.

Guess they lost a customer for life and I won’t promote them to friends and family anymore.

Be careful if you decide to sell it.
